Following the Kaehee's is an emotionally-raw and lyrical narrative exploring the turbulant and awkward time of life when high school is over and real life has yet to begin. For Michael and Kelly this point of life is especially harsh. Their friendship having ended in their first year of high school, Kelly becoming popular while Michael was left as a target to the school's homophobia. But upon graduation they are brought together by the story of Joan and Gordon Kaehee; an elderly couple that had vanished one day and set off a nation-wide frenzy. Armed with their unrelenting curiousity to learn the truth. Kelly and Michael set off on a road trip that leads them to more than just the facts about the Kaehee's...it leads them to each other and themselves.
